📌 A W5500 Module That Carries Its Own Maker Mark
Nex-G Automation LLP is an electronics design and hardware firm of up to ten people in Hubballi, Karnataka, GST registered in 2019 under the legal status Partnership, that supplies industrial automation and worker safety hardware such as network hooters, relay boards and water treatment data loggers. Nex-G Automation also sells one board-level part, the NXG-W5500-MOD, a W5500 Ethernet plug-in module with the RJ45 jack already fitted.
The vendor names the chip in its own technical document and repeats the same sentence in the product listing: "It features the WIZnet W5500 hardwired TCP/IP chip with integrated RJ45 port, SPI interface, and ultra-low-power design."

What the Technical Document Specifies
The file linked from the listing as Product Brochure is a three page PDF titled "W5500 Ethernet Plugin Module, RJ45 Ethernet Interface for Embedded Systems, Technical Document v1.0", carrying the line "Model Series: NXG-W5500-MOD" and a footer reading "Copyright © 2025 NEX-G Automation LLP". Its internal creation timestamp reads 28 June 2025, matching the June 2025 upload path on IndiaMART.
The feature list claims a "Hardware TCP/IP stack (8 independent sockets)", an "SPI interface for host microcontroller (up to 80 MHz)", support for "TCP, UDP, ICMP, IPv4, ARP, IGMP, PPPoE", and compatibility with "STM32, Arduino, ESP32, Raspberry Pi, NXP, TI MCUs".
| Parameter | Value published by Nex-G Automation | Where it is stated |
|---|---|---|
| Supply voltage | 3.3V regulated, logic level 3.3V | Electrical Specifications, brochure page 2 |
| Ethernet speed | 10/100 Mbps full duplex | Key Features and Electrical Specifications |
| Power consumption | under 180 mA | Electrical Specifications, brochure page 2 |
| Operating temperature | -40 degrees C to +85 degrees C | Key Features and Electrical Specifications |
| Maximum cable run | 100 meters | Max Transfer Distance field, IndiaMART listing |
| Ordering code and packing | NXG-W5500-MOD, anti-static bag, optional tray or bulk pack | Ordering Information, brochure page 3 |
The pin list runs to twelve positions in two rows of six: GND, GND, MOSI, SCLK, nSS and nINT on the left, then GND, VIN 3.3V, VIN 3.3V, N.C., nRESET and MISO on the right. That order matches the pin-out drawing the seller also posts in the gallery, which is the arrangement used by the widely copied W5500 module footprint, so the part drops into an existing socket rather than asking for a new one.

⚙️ Role of the W5500 on This Board
The W5500 is what makes the module a plug-in rather than a wiring adapter. The chip holds the TCP/IP state machine, the MAC and the PHY in one package, so the host microcontroller runs no software stack: it writes a destination address and payload into one of eight hardware sockets over SPI and reads received bytes back the same way. WIZnet documents that register layout and socket model at docs.wiznet.io.
The hardware stack is why the brochure can list STM32, Arduino, ESP32, Raspberry Pi, NXP and TI parts side by side. Any of those hosts needs only an SPI port, a chip select, a reset line and an optional interrupt, which is exactly the twelve pin footprint Nex-G Automation publishes. A microcontroller with no Ethernet MAC gains a wired port, and one that has a MAC can skip the external PHY, the magnetics and the impedance controlled traces.
What the module leaves out matters as much. There is no Power over Ethernet path and no second interface, and the three page document mentions no Wi-Fi, Bluetooth, LoRa or Zigbee, so the NXG-W5500-MOD is a wired-only building block.
What the Seller Photographs Show, and What They Do Not
The listing gallery holds six images and only two are photographs of this board, both 1514 x 2000 pixels. Enlarging the first shows the white silkscreen along the lower edge: a NEX-G AUTOMATION wordmark, a Make in India lion emblem, and the address www.nexgautomation.com printed onto the green solder mask, evidence that the board is built to the company's own artwork rather than resold in someone else's livery.
The same photograph resolves the connector: the metal shield of the jack is stamped HanRun HR961160C with date code 2415, the fifteenth week of 2024, about a year before the brochure was written.
Crops enlarged and rotated from the seller photograph, with no text added to the board. Source: indiamart.com.
Three details deserve caution. The pad rows are plated through holes filled with solder and no header is fitted in either shot, while the listing's Mounting Type field says "Male burg pins" and the brochure says "castellated pins". Neither photograph shows the face that carries the controller, so no chip marking is legible anywhere in the gallery and the W5500 identification rests on the vendor text. The other four gallery images are not photographs of this unit: two are the generic pin-out and dimension drawings that circulate with commodity W5500 modules, one shows a board whose silkscreen does not form readable text, and one is a render of the brochure's first page.

Value and Open Questions
For an Indian OEM or design house the appeal is procurement rather than novelty. A W5500 module at 850 rupees from a GST registered seller in Karnataka arrives with a domestic tax invoice and a domestic courier, and the vendor offers tray or bulk packing for production quantities.
Several things a buyer would want are unpublished. Nex-G Automation releases no schematic, no bill of materials and no driver or example firmware; the ISO 9001:2015 mark appears only as a footer line on the brochure with no certificate located; and "Designed & manufactured in India under Make in India" is the vendor's own wording rather than an audited statement. The product also depends on a single listing, with no other page for it anywhere.

❓ FAQ
Q. Which WIZnet chip is in the NXG-W5500-MOD and where is that stated? The W5500, named in the same sentence in two places, the three page technical document and the IndiaMART listing text: "It features the WIZnet W5500 hardwired TCP/IP chip with integrated RJ45 port, SPI interface, and ultra-low-power design."
Q. How much does the module cost and can it be bought today? The IndiaMART listing showed 850 rupees per piece excluding all taxes on 27 August 2026, marked In Stock and shipping from Hubballi. Ordering runs through the IndiaMART enquiry flow or by mail to sales@nexgautomation.com.
Q. How does a microcontroller connect to it? Over SPI, using the twelve pins the brochure publishes: MOSI, MISO, SCLK, nSS, nRESET and nINT for signals, two 3.3V VIN pins and three grounds, with one pin left unconnected. The brochure gives the SPI interface as usable up to 80 MHz on a 3.3V supply.
Q. Is this an in-house Nex-G design or a rebranded commodity module? The photographed board carries the NEX-G AUTOMATION wordmark, a Make in India lion and the company URL in its own silkscreen, and it follows the standard twelve pin W5500 module footprint. No schematic is published, so the printing and the footprint are what can be confirmed.
Q. Does the module support Power over Ethernet or any wireless link? No. The brochure and the listing describe a 3.3V, SPI, 10/100 Mbps wired interface only, and the three page document mentions no PoE, Wi-Fi, Bluetooth, LoRa or Zigbee.
